We visited Bibo Norte Carago twice during our holiday, and both times it was excellent from every point of view: traditional food, generous portions, great flavor, and very fair prices. 🍽️🔥 We tried Bacalhau à Zé do Pipo, Tripas à moda do Porto, Posta à moda do Norte, traditional sausage Alheira, and the Molotov dessert – everything was delicious, homemade, and full of flavor. For those staying at Dom Pedro Garajau: do NOT settle for the snack bars right across the street. The food there is, at best, mediocre. Some of those places try to act like fine dining, but they’re just overpriced taverns with attitude. One even told us we couldn’t share a dish because “only one item is para compartir.” LOL. 🤷‍♀️ This place is about 550 meters from the hotel, but every step is 100% worth it. Here you get real Madeiran and northern Portuguese food, warm service, and honest prices. Would absolutely come back! 🌿💛

Really nice restaurant to eat. The waiter was super friendly, talked with us a lot, and gave recommendations regarding the food. The food was super good, we had ordered the octupus and codfish. Also the mashed potatoes are to recommend especially. It didn’t bother us but just be aware that they use a lot of olive oil. Also the desserts were really sweet, if you like that then it shouldn’t be a problem. I definitely recommend the place.
